The fruit is widely used for juices, jams, herbal remedies, and skincare products. Sea Buckthorn is also a nitrogen fixing plant, improving soil while providing habitat and food for wildlife. This resilient shrub thrives in poor soils and windy locations, making it popular for permaculture gardens, edible landscapes, and erosion control plantings. Note: Male and female plants are required for fruit production. Botanical Name: Hippophae rhamnoides Common Name: Sea Buckthorn Type: Deciduous shrub USDA Zones: 3–8 Height: 6–15 feet Bloom Time: Spring Fruit: Bright orange berries in late summer to fall Light: Full sun Soil: Poor to average, well drained Water Needs: Low once established Cold stratification recommended – 60–90 days improves germination. Sow seeds about 1/4 inch deep in moist soil. Keep soil lightly moist until germination. Germination may take 3–6 weeks after stratification.
